Street Beat was a Danish band formed in 1982 by Henrik Carlsen (keyboards) and Bo Møller (bass). Drummer Kristian Skovgård Lassen joined the band shortly after. The three of them stayed together until 1993.

Many famous Danish artists and musicians have started their career with a stint in the band.

In 1984 Street Beat recorded two singles for Steinar Records in London. The first record was one of the first European female rap (by Cæcilie Norby, later internationally known jazz singer).

The only album was Gaga Jungle Land, released in 1986 and only in Denmark.

Street Beat started off as a funky almost bigband but became much more rockorientated later on.
